2014-10-03 2 views
3

Я добавил текстовое поле (keyboardTextField) поверх моей пользовательской клавиатуры. Я могу выбрать его и ввести текст (используя мою собственную клавиатуру). Но я не могу выбрать входной вид основного приложения назад. Эта строка кодаИспользование UITextField внутри расширения приложения для клавиатуры

[keyboardTextField resignFirstResponder]; 

не работает правильно. Если у кого-то есть обходной путь или какие-либо идеи, мне нужна ваша помощь.

+0

Отметьте этот ответ: http://stackoverflow.com/a/34455421/1010644 Я использовал его в своем приложении. – landonandrey

ответ

0

Я исправил это, добавив кнопку, которая переключает пользовательский ввод с UILabel (в моем случае) на UITextField (normal - iOS) в сообщениях f.e.

Я проверяю BOOL, чтобы увидеть, где ввести пользовательский символ.

Смежные вопросы